This mouse is great, but that software...
Edit: I'm taking this from a 3 to a 4 star because the wired version is better. I bought the wired version so I could have one at my desk constantly and another for my portable bag. The wired software is different from the wireless (Pro) mouse's software. You can only have 2 active profiles on the Pro version and there are only 3 RGB options overall. For some reason the wired mouse has 5 profiles saved to the device at a time and offers 5 differing options for the RGB, which is actually practical on this device so you can tell at a glance which profile you have loaded without having to go into the software. The software is still weird and has a pretty steep learning curve (the problem with mouse speed on my original review was due to the 5 different DPI levels you can set to each profile where I wrote over the DPI + and - buttons on my work profiles. That combined with windows constantly turning on "Enhanced Pointer Precision" was causing most of my problems). Why the wired version of the mouse has seperate/better options and an easier to understand interface than the "Pro" version I will never understand.I use this mouse for CAD design software so I can use all my shortcuts with my right hand and keep my left hand on the numberpad. You can have 2 separate profiles saved to the mouse that you switch between with a button on the underside of the mouse. I have one set to common macros and another set for general editing purposes (copy, paste, backspace, escape, and delete on a mouse shortcut are all surprisingly useful).
